Textuary

Tex"tu*a*ry , a. [Cf. F. textuaire.] 1. Contained in the text; textual. Sir T. Browne. 2. Serving as a text; authoritative. Glanvill.

Textuary

Tex"tu*a*ry, n. [Cf. F. textuaire.] 1. One who is well versed in the Scriptures; a textman. Bp. Bull. 2. One who adheres strictly or rigidly to the text.
